A heap of Thanksgiving measurement

Thanksgiving table set with a turkey and side dishes

In our modern age we rely on precision in our measurements. Even when we don’t need it, our devices give it to us. Google maps tell us how far away Grandma’s house is, down to the tenth of a mile.
